Nnajax truclient protocol pdf

Loadrunner vugen scripting how to automatically download file from server and save it to local disk. The new ajax truclient technology is a new, browserbased virtual user generator vugen to support modern javascriptbased web applications, including ajax. During the test, i want the virtual users to click on any of those links ramdomly. Recording our first test with the truclient chrome extension. The truclient engine records your actions as you navigate through. Loadrunner records file transferring from server and does not record file saving. Introduction to vugen virtual user generator script. It utilizes a unique, patented approach to object recognition that provides clients with a flexible and extensible solution for testing web 2. You are on a path you do not want to be on with your assertion on writing to a file the captured element. There doesnt seem to be much technical information on truclient out there yet, so i thought i would start a thread focusing on how tos and any useful information pertaining to truclient. My question is specific to transaction duration times displaying in the interactive reply log. Loadrunner vugen scripting how to automatically download. This looks more like a generic function to add fields in header.

Accelerating the path to testing modern applications us english. For ajax truclient, the time taken to download a pdf file can be found out by using web page breakdown graph in analysis. More specifically, there have been improvements and modifications for using it with firefox as well as a new addition in way of support for internet explorer 9 with the ajax truclient protocol. I cant imagine how anyone could run a 500 user test using this protocol, getting maybe 3 vusers per load injector. I have an app that has a gui dialog that pops up a download window to attach a pdf to be sent. While recording, i clicked on one of those 100 links. Ive recorded a script using the truclient protocol in which part of the business process for the webapp under test requires uploading a. The ajax truclient protocol has to do javascript evaluation on the client for dom objects that takes time for rendering a page. Ajax truclient protocol in load runner to disable the popups from appearing. Memory and cpu requirements vary per protocol and system under test.

Hp loadrunner v11 00 ajax truclient tips and tricks everyone working with truclient should have a copy of hps tips and tricks document from truclient. If you are working with truclient, here are some of the best online resources to get you started. Ajax truclient advantages ajax truclient protocol was introduced to loadrunner in version 11. How to upload files in scripting load runner vugen blogger. Getting started with loadrunner, eclipse and selenium. All parameter files are loaded into ram in order to avoid unnecessary disk activity during the test so. I have been doing considerable amount of work using loadrunner 11 and truclient. There are protocols to support these, or you can use one of the standard protocols i. How to convert pdf to word without software duration. It is embedded in the browser, and provides interactive recording and scripting, which removes the need for programming during scripting.

Recording the scenario in truclient, however does not open the download pop up, so. Typically you would use these applications to record common user activities and the transaction uses the script to synthetically recreate user activity. How to save visible text in a variable in ajax truclient protocol in loadrunner 11. No matter what website i try and go to i get the message server not found to check the address and maks sure that firefox is permitted to access the web. But i just read this an a support pdf from hp can anyone confirm this. Hp truclient technology for testing modern applications. In script view, other protocol script can be edited. Provides unlimited users for truclient native mobile protocol, but requires hpe mobile center license. Ajax truclient protocol is a major protocol introduced in load runner from version 11.

The following table displays the methods and step arguments categorized by browser, object, utils, transactions, log, argument, parameters that can be used as values in truclient coded steps. It is important for beginners to focus more on the scripting part. Accelerating the path to testing modern applications business white paper. Ajax truclient protocol overview the ajax truclient protocol interactively records scripts as you navigate through your business process. All arguments can accept javascript code as values. Windows updates before you install any loadrunner components, either make sure that the full set of windows updates has been installed, or install the. Lastly, the students will learn how to use the truclient protocol to create advanced web scripts. Community 50 vusers for all protocols, except for comdcom, templates and gui mobile ui unlimited vusers for the truclient native mobile protocol. The truclient protocol provides clientside performance data for web applications. It is used to test applications, measuring system behaviour and performance under load. Hp truclient supports the industrys broadest range of applications and.

New hp truclient technology reduces application test cycles by simplifying one. Before you begin, save yourself some time and make sure that youre using the 32bit version of eclipsei actually had an issue getting this to work at first, and had to open a ticket with hp support. Just got lr 11 vugen licence and tried truclient, looks great and the firefox based script recording works really nice. When i record a script using truclient ajax ie protocol i get an error as below. Click the step button in the truclient menu toolbar. Hi new to truclient and have been reading everything i can to get up to speed on this protocol, including this thread. Im used to getting 5075 virtual users web per load injector pc. Metrics collection for mobile browser based applications. Not able to record through vugen ajax tru client protocol. How to save visible text in a variable in ajax truclient. Using oracle nca protocol how can we deal with this file upload function. Do you know how to corelate values in ajax truclient protocol scripts. Vugen does not have a direct way of finding this information as in web protocol.

Qainsights performance testing blog tools, training. When i try to record the script using ajax tru client protocol i am not able to record, but when i try to open the url which i want to record in firefox its opening the url, but if i try the same thing to record the script by opening the url i am getting server not found. To initiate the upload, you click on the upload file button found on the page, which produces the windows filepicker. If you cant find a protocol you might want to consider using a remote access protocol such as rdp or citrix. Learn the first component of loadrunner with recording and creating a basic vugen script. Bundle name protocols remote desktop microsoft rdp remote desktop protocol rich internet applications ajaxclick and script flex truclient mobile web truclient web sap sap gui sapweb smp sap mobile platform soa ibm mqseriesclient ibm mqseriesserver uft api converts unified functional testing api tests to become loadenabled. Robust support for different ajax control such as slider, calendar, accordion. I only ask that we keep this thread limited to how tos and useful information. Howto find out time taken to download a pdf file in ajax. Currently i am not able to find something on ajax truclient protocol in vugen hp virtual user generator 11. Yes, although truclient vusers do not scale as web. This release was originally going to be called loadrunner 12. The icon changes to, and the step is added to the list of favorites the favorites tab is the default tab when there are favorite steps.

This enables truclient to easily record and replay dynamic, complex webbased applications and create user friendly scripts. I primarily work on micro focus loadrunner web, web services, truclient, and truweb protocols, apache jmeter, neotys neoload, dynatrace, and splunk. How to fix common vugen recording problems jds australia. Hover over each step that you want to add as a favorite, and click the favorites icon. This is the scenario there is a search criterion giving me 100 search results 100 links. The only document or user guide available on this protocol seems to be the hp loadrunner v11 00 ajax truclient tips and tricks. The numerous handson lab exercises are designed to provide. In this handson loadrunner training series, a brief introduction on loadrunner was given in our previous tutorial in this tutorial, we will start with vugen virtual user generator which is the first component of the loadrunner tool. Recently active truclient questions stack overflow.

Not able to record through vugen ajax tru client protocol problem detail. Truclientweb protocol across multiple browsers, and enhanced integration with hpe network. Is there any documentation, user guide or help files on ajax trueclient protocol firefox. Unlimited vusers for the truclientnative mobile protocol.

In script view, ajax truclient script is read only. The numerous handson lab exercises are designed to provide you with the knowledge necessary to create scripts in vugen, execute scenarios in the controller, and view the results in the analysis tool. Loadrunner can simulate thousands of users concurrently using application software, recording and later analyzing the performance of key. Ajax trueclient protocal using loadrunner loadrunner ajax trueclient protocol. Other protocols are not asynchronous in nature, truclient record and replays each action at user level. Truclient is a tool for recording webbased applications.

Loadrunner is a software testing tool from micro focus. Having said that i think the compatibility is not an issue because we get the javascipt function details when using browser agent with trueclient. Truclient is not just for ajaxbased web pages it can work on any web page that. I understand it uses the mozilla firefox to develop the script.

Please click the below subscribe button to get notified brand new. I tried a workaround with loadrunner ajax click ans script protocol to execute in controller with out ajax click n script license record a script with ajax clicknscript protocol. What to do, if you have to save transferred file to local disk. Can we run multiple true client users on the same load generator like web protocol. A script transaction is a script recorded in truclient or vugen. Hp truclient technology supports simple web as well as modern javascriptbased applications.

16 1253 1471 1425 345 722 743 1269 271 1412 550 244 219 476 1451 1295 286 257 118 25 1058 381 431 857 278 876 559 1432 297 1500 337 827 1428 111 412 605 866 637 668 110 767 470 725 255 1239